1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are high frequency words?
Back
High frequency words are common words that appear often in written text. They are important for reading fluency.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Give an example of a high frequency word.
Back
Examples include 'the', 'and', 'is', 'to', 'you'.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Why are high frequency words important?
Back
They help students read more fluently and understand texts better.
